# FY Headcount Plan — Sales Org (Managers Only)

Northquill's sales headcount for next year is set at 42 roles, up six from current. The Veldmar region gets three of the new hires; the remainder go to the Ostrey inside-sales pod. Backfills require sign-off from Dena Crowhurst before posting. Ramp assumptions stay at four months for field roles, two for inside sales. Freeze windows mirror last year's quarter-end pattern. The rationale behind the regional split is covered in the note below.

internal memo for kawip-hadug: Headcount on the Wenwyn team goes from 7 to 140 by the end of January. Gross margin on Wenwyn came in at 20 percent against a plan of 15 percent.

Handover note — Crumbwheel order cutoffs.

Welcome aboard. The bakery cutoff rule in Crumbwheel closes same-day orders at 14:00 local to each storefront, not UTC — this has bitten us twice. Holiday overrides live in the calendar service and take precedence silently, so always check there first when a cutoff looks wrong. To unlock the calendar service's admin console after a restart, enter the recovery passphrase below.

vault phrase of bagap-bahaf = silion-pelox-sorox-casdor-quenwyn-fraax-eliox-praael-kelion-quenvan-kasox-rusael-norius-belvan

Heads up on the SQL linter in the Quarrybase CI. It flags uppercase keywords as errors even though our style guide allows them — known quirk, fix is pending. Add a lint-ignore comment at the top of the file rather than reformatting everything. If the job still fails, rerun once before pinging anyone, and attach the build token printed below.

pipeline stamp: htk31_f769b577b3028a4e9958e5bb8d1259a